Sonoran
Sonoran is a mineral sands project in development in Approximately 9 km southeast of Jacinth-Ambrosia, South Australia, Australia. It is recorded at approximately -30.947, 132.297, and appears in this directory's consolidated register of Australian mines and quarries, built from government geological-survey data.
The site is recorded as a development-stage project — somewhere between advanced exploration and first production. Development statuses move quickly; check the operator's own announcements for the latest position.
Additional recorded details — the recorded operator is Iluka Resources Limited; published resource summary: 27.5 Mt material at 7.2% HM for 2 Mt in-situ HM at 22.9% zircon, 66.1% ilmenite, 2.4% rutile & 0.24% monazite + xenotime..
